Understanding Flowcharts in Google Sheets

Flowcharts are visual representations of a process, algorithm, or workflow. They use symbols and connecting lines to illustrate the sequence of steps, decisions, and outcomes. In Google Sheets, flowcharts can help you understand, communicate, and document your data-driven processes more effectively.

Before we dive into creating flowcharts, let's understand why they are crucial. Flowcharts help identify bottlenecks, improve processes, and facilitate team collaboration. They also make your data more engaging and easier to understand, especially for non-technical stakeholders.

Creating Flowcharts in Google Sheets

To create a flowchart in Google Sheets, you'll need to install the 'draw.io Diagrams for Google Drive' add-on. Here's a step-by-step guide:

1. Open your Google Sheets document and click on 'Add-ons' in the menu.
2. Select 'draw.io Diagrams for Google Drive' and then click on 'Start'.
3. A new tab will open with the draw.io editor. Choose a flowchart template or start from scratch.
4. Use the toolbar to add shapes, connect them with lines, and customize your flowchart.
5. Once done, click on 'Save & Close'. Your flowchart will be inserted into your Google Sheets document.

Customizing Your Flowchart

draw.io offers a wide range of customization options. You can change the color, style, and size of shapes, add text and images, and even use conditional formatting to make your flowchart interactive.

To customize your flowchart, select the shape or element you want to modify. The toolbar will change to offer options specific to that element. You can also right-click on an element to access its context menu.

Use Cases of Google Sheets Flowcharts

Flowcharts in Google Sheets can be used in various ways, such as:

1. Process Documentation: Flowcharts can help document complex processes, making it easier to understand and follow them.

2. Data Visualization: By representing data as a flowchart, you can make it more engaging and easier to understand.

3. Project Management: Flowcharts can help visualize project workflows, identify dependencies, and track progress.
